About this course

By enrolling in this course, learners will gain expertise in Full Stack Web Development, including HTML5, CSS3, JavaScript, jQuery, Node.js, React, and more. They will also learn best practices in responsive design, version control, and project management, enabling them to create professional, user-friendly, and dynamic websites. Upon completion, learners will have a strong portfolio of web development projects to showcase their skills to potential employers or clients. This advanced skill certificate is a valuable asset for freelancers, career changers, or those looking to enhance their current skillset, providing a competitive edge in the job market and ensuring long-term career success.
